Orlando, Florida – TNA Wrestling fans witnessed an intense night of action at Slammiversary 2024 as new champions were crowned and title changes took place. One of the highlights of the event was the TNA Wrestling Tag Team Championship match, where Brian Myers and Eddie Edwards from the System defended their titles against Ace Austin and Chris Bey, known as ABC.
In a thrilling showdown, ABC emerged victorious, capturing the TNA World Tag Team Championship. The event also featured other title matches and special appearances by WWE NXT stars, adding to the excitement of the night.
The card for Slammiversary showcased a variety of matches, including the TNA World Championship bout featuring Moose defending his title against Josh Alexander, Frankie Kazarian, Nic Nemeth, Steve Maclin, and Joe Hendry in a six-way elimination match. Additionally, fans witnessed Jordynne Grace defend her Knockouts Championship against Ash by Elegance, and Mustafa Ali putting his X-Division Championship on the line against Mike Bailey.
Other matches on the card included Brian Myers & Eddie Edwards defending the TNA World Tag Team Championship against Ace Austin & Chris Bey, as well as AJ Francis (Dolla Two Belts) facing off against PCO for both the TNA Digital Media Championship and the International Heavyweight Wrestling Championship.
The night also saw intense battles between Rascalz and No Quarter Catch Crew, Matt Hardy and Johnny Dango Curtis, as well as Mike Santana and Jake Something, adding to the excitement and drama of the event.
